describe the development of speech, from infancy to approximately two years of age.
The speech development from infancy to approximately two years of age involves a progression of prelinguistic and linguistic milestones, including cooing, babbling, single words, and the emergence of two-word combinations.
During the first few months of infancy, babies start by producing vowel-like sounds and cooing. Around six months, they begin babbling, producing repetitive syllables like "ba-ba" or "da-da." By the age of one, they typically start using their first recognizable words, such as "mama" or "dada," to refer to specific people or objects. As they approach two years of age, their vocabulary expands, and they begin to combine two words together to form simple phrases or sentences.

which of the following is the mechanism of action of amantadine (symadine)?
Amantadine, also known as Symadine, is an antiviral and antiparkinsonian medication. Amantadine is an NMDA receptor antagonist and dopaminergic medication that works by inhibiting viral replication.
It has been used to treat Parkinson's disease (PD) and drug-induced extrapyramidal syndromes (EPRs). It is also used to treat influenza A virus infections.
The precise mechanism of action of amantadine is unknown, but it is thought to involve several mechanisms, including the following:
Blocking of viral replication - Amantadine may prevent the uncoating of the influenza A virus, preventing its replication and propagation in host cells.
Increasing dopaminergic activity - Amantadine increases the release of dopamine, a neurotransmitter that is reduced in PD, by increasing its release or reducing its reuptake.
NMDA receptor antagonism - Amantadine blocks NMDA receptors in the brain, which reduces the excitotoxicity that can occur in various neurological conditions, including PD. Amantadine is rapidly absorbed after oral administration and reaches peak plasma levels within two to four hours. Its side effects include gastrointestinal disturbances, nervousness, anxiety, and confusion.

the tendency to think that other people are more susceptible to attributional biases in their thinking than we are is a(n)
The tendency to think that other people are more susceptible to attributional biases in their thinking than we are is a bias blind spot.
The bias blind spot is a cognitive bias that causes people to be less aware of their own biases than of those of others, and to assume that they're less susceptible to biases than others. The bias blind spot can strongly influence people, including you, in a variety of domains, so it's important to understand it. It can cause people to assume that they're less likely to experience various biases than their peers or the general population.
It can cause people to fail to realize that they're displayed a certain bias, even when they're given an explicit description of the bias and are asked whether it could have influenced their reasoning.

Indian Judiciary is known for its impartiality all the citizens of India can get access to courts. To deal with it conveniently, it has separate courts – the civil and the criminal court.
Do you have any idea what type of cases go into the criminal courts and the civil courts? Explain briefly with examples.
Answer:
In India, the criminal courts are responsible for hearing and deciding cases involving crimes or offenses that are punishable under the Indian Penal Code or other criminal laws. These cases are typically brought by the state or the government against an individual or group accused of committing a crime. Examples of criminal cases include murder, theft, robbery, assault, and drug offenses.
On the other hand, civil courts are responsible for hearing and deciding cases involving disputes between individuals, organizations, or the government and individuals or organizations. These cases are typically brought by one party against another party, and may involve issues such as property disputes, contracts, torts, and other civil matters. Examples of civil cases include disputes over the ownership of property, breach of contract cases, personal injury cases, and divorce cases.

Which of the following properties is not eligible for the §179 expense election when purchased?
a. A business automobile.
b. A business computer.
c. Rental property.
d. Manufacturing equipment.
The property that is not eligible for the §179 expense election when purchased is rental property.
The §179 expense election is a provision in the U.S. tax code that allows businesses to deduct the cost of qualifying property as an expense rather than capitalizing and depreciating it over time. This provision is designed to provide businesses with immediate tax relief for certain types of property.
While business automobiles, business computers, and manufacturing equipment are generally eligible for the §179 expense election, rental property is specifically excluded. Rental property is considered a different category of investment property, and its expenses and depreciation are subject to different tax rules. Expenses related to rental property are typically deducted over the property's useful life or through other applicable deductions for rental property owners.

The Law of Supply is a direct relationship between price and quantity supplied. The Law of Supply states that producers will offer more of a product at higher prices and less of a product at lower prices. Producers supply more goods and services when they can sell them at higher prices.
